Transaction 52ff316db84b2cb40199a5b0e323097ee9836e06bcb7380c848d851729bfea2a
1 Input
1 Output
-
52ff316db84b2cb40199a5b0e323097ee9836e06bcb7380c848d851729bfea2a:0
- value
- 589639
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4ffb683bf03bf642134c7fa4617880b8a070edd
- address
- bc1qknlmdqalqwlkggf5clayv9ugpw9qwrkarxanpr